Lucas Paqueta officially signs for West Ham United for club record €60 million

West Ham United have officially announced the arrival of Lucas Paqueta on a permanent transfer from Lyon. The Brazilian has signed for a record fee worth €60 million. 

Lyon have been paid €43 million upfront plus €17 million in add-ons for the midfielder. He has completed all the medicals and formalities to make the move official, and will soon feature under David Moyes in the Premier League. 

Lucas Paqueta joins West Ham United 

The player has signed a five-year contract with the Hammers, and has the option to extend the deal for another year included as well. 

“I am extremely happy to be here. I hope it’s the beginning of an enjoyable journey. I hope my time here is successful,” said the South American, who will wear the No11 shirt in Claret and Blue.

“Last season, West Ham had a very good season and I hope they continue to enjoy more and more good seasons in my time at the Club.

“I am excited to pull on the West Ham shirt and show the fans what I can do, to help my team-mates and the Club.”

The Brazilian is the latest, and possibly last addition of the transfer window for David Moyes. West Ham United have recruited Gianluca Scamacca, Nayef Aguerd, Maxwel Cornet, Thilo Kehrer and Emerson to challenge for European place while mounting a challenge in the Conference League as well.
